What maximum size can an adult male Eastern Water Dragon sometimes exceed?

Answer

One meter from snout to tail tip

The physical maturity of the adult male Eastern Water Dragon is notable for its substantial size relative to many other native reptiles. Males possess powerful builds, and when fully grown, their length, measured precisely from the snout all the way to the tail tip, can occasionally surpass the one-meter threshold. This impressive maximum size distinguishes the adult males, who are also sexually dimorphic by being larger than their female counterparts, whose growth tends to plateau at a lesser maximum length.
